On 30 Aug 1998, Testeroste wrote:

> 1.  Problem:  When I try to compile, I get a message -- 
> 
> Error in DJGPP instalation
> Environment variable DJGPP point to file 'C:\DJGPP\DJGPP.ENV',
> which does not exist.

Does this happen when you invoke GCC from the DOS prompt, or from
RHIDE?  If you didn't try to compile from the command line, please try
and tell if this problem persists.

If the problem happens with command-line compiles as well, please type
the following from the DOS prompt:

    set > env.lst
    dir c:\djgpp > djgpp.lst

then post here the contents of the two files `env.lst' and `djgpp.lst'
created by these commands.

> 2.  go32 tells me that DPMI memory is 29k kb, swap space is 33k kb.

This is okay, there's nothing to worry about here.
